At the heart of this revolution lies the power of machine learning. By training algorithms on vast troves of consumer data, AI can identify patterns and trends that would be nearly impossible for humans to discern. This has led to a new era of hyper-targeted marketing, where messages are tailored to individual consumers based on their behavior, preferences, and needs.

But the impact of AI goes far beyond mere personalization. In a world where consumers are bombarded with content and ads, cutting through the noise has become more challenging than ever. Enter AI-powered content generation, capable of creating compelling, engaging, and unique content at a scale that was previously unimaginable. This technology is not only transforming the way marketers communicate with their audience but also revolutionizing the very nature of storytelling itself.

Another game-changer in the AI-driven marketing landscape is predictive analytics. By crunching numbers and analyzing patterns, AI can forecast consumer behavior, allowing marketers to stay one step ahead of the competition. Armed with this information, companies can optimize their marketing strategies, making data-driven decisions that lead to increased sales and customer loyalty.

Yet, despite the numerous benefits AI offers, it also raises ethical questions and challenges. Concerns about privacy and data security are more pressing than ever, as companies grapple with the implications of using AI to collect and analyze vast amounts of personal information. Moreover, the potential for biased algorithms and the spread of misinformation remains a pressing concern in the era of AI-driven content generation.
